This audio guide introduces the surroundings of the next station Dockland. It explains the building after which the station is named. The guide also describes a free-fall lifeboat and listeners learn about the Cruise Center Altona. The audio guide places Dockland within the wider historical context of the Altona district, from its origins as a fishing village to its Danish and Prussian past.
